English: 5,832 GRT passenger liner SS Ormiston (right) being assisted by a tug (left) at Brisbane in about 1936. A Stephen & Sons of Glasgow built her in 1922 as Famaka for the Khedivial Mail Steamship & Graving Dock Company. In 1931 Eastern Traders Ltd bought her, renamed her Ormiston and registered her in Melbourne. in 1939 Australian United Steamship Navigation Company bought her, keeping the same name. Greek owners bought her in 1955 and sold her for scrap in 1957. |
